Fishlips Bar & Bistro
If you want to go where the locals go for seafood in Cairns, this is the place. You can try the local barramundi or be more adventurous and order the pan-fried crocodile!
Met Bar
A cigar only seems fitting after a hearty meal of kangaroo. The sophisticated cigar lounge here offers the perfect setting.
Wait-a-While Rainforest Tours
Many rainforest animals are nocturnal and difficult to spot during the day. If you’re a little nocturnal yourself, consider one of these tours designed to maximize wildlife encounters. They start at 3:00 pm and end around 11:00 pm.
Barfly
A free entertainment newspaper, Barfly is published every Thursday and will guide you to the after-hours hot spots and local music scene in Cairns. Be sure to pick one up.
Fishing Cairns
Cairns is the black marlin capital of the world. Whether you want to reel in one of these giant fish or try your skill against a barracuda or a tiger shark, this outfit can get you to the secret spots.
Cairns Esplanade
Get a taste of local life as well as a little exercise at this Cairns focal point. Go for a morning jog, join families flying kites, or take a swim in the lagoon.
Reef House Day Spa
Visit this spa in the Sebel Reef House Hotel for a little rejuvenation. The Kodo Body Massage—a rhythmic massage using ancient Aboriginal techniques—should do the trick.
